Product Description
Raymond OEM grease fitting RA 671-012-22 is a press-in lubrication point designed for the chassis and caster assemblies of Raymond 8300, 8400, and 8500 series electric lift trucks. Constructed of case-hardened low carbon steel and engineered for maximum durability, this non-threaded fitting withstands up to 3,500 PSI and is compatible with standard NLGI Grade 2 grease.
Compatibility: Fits pallet jacks made by Raymond, model 8300, 8400, 8500. SKU: RA 671-012-22
